Hyundai Accent: Disassembly| 1. |
Inspection of parts
Each part, when removed, should be carefully on suspected
for malfunction, deformation, damage, and other problems.
|
| 2. |
Arrangement of parts
All disassembled parts should be carefully arranged
for effective reassembly.
Be sure to separate and correctly identify the parts
to be replaced from those that will be used again.
|
| 3. |
Cleaning parts for reuse
All parts to be used again should be carefully and
thoroughly cleaned by an appropriate method.
